суббота, 23 марта 2019 г.

Docker ERROR: failed to register layer: symlink ..

После запуска docker-compose up не скачивался образ и вываливалась ошибка: ERROR: failed to register layer: symlink ..

Решение следующее:

1) Чистим в /var/lib/docker папки overlay2 image volumes
2) Перезапускаем докер service docker restart
3) Пробуем заново docker-compose up

пятница, 22 марта 2019 г.

Exim smarthost или отправляем письма через локальный релей

Ситуация была такова что с Zabbix хоста нужно было пускать уведомления на локальные почтовые ящики. На хосте с заббиксом установил Exim и нужно было отправлять письма через релей (Postfix)

Вкратце схема такова.

 SRV  ======================> SRV =============> SRV
(Exim)                     (Postfix)        (MS Exchange)

среда, 20 марта 2019 г.

PostgreSQL аналог show full processlist

SELECT * FROM pg_stat_activity;

Установка Zabbix 4.06 с PostgreSQL на Ubuntu 18.04

Ман по установке Zabbix 4.0 с СУБД PSQL на Ubuntu 18.04. Написал свой т.к во время установки возникали проблемы и  пришлось решать различного рода ошибки.

1) Добавляем репу 4.0
wget https://repo.zabbix.com/zabbix/4.0/ubuntu/pool/main/z/zabbix-release/zabbix-release_4.0-2+bionic_all.deb
dpkg -i zabbix-release_4.0-2+bionic_all.deb
apt update

2) apt install zabbix-server-pgsql zabbix-frontend-php postgresql postgresql-contrib mc php7.2-pgsql

3) Меняем значение в конфиге PSQL с peer на md5 
mcedit /etc/postgresql/10/main/pg_hba.conf

local     all       all                                md5

host      all      all      127.0.0.1/32     md5

Postgresql базовые команды

Для того чтобы войти в консоль PostgreSQL пишем 

sudo -i -u postgres

затем

psql


Команды psql
\c dbname - подсоединение к БД dbname.
\l - список баз данных.
\dt - список всех таблиц.
\d table - структура таблицы table.
\du - список всех пользователей и их привилегий.
\dt+ - список всех таблиц с описанием.
\dt *s* - список всех таблиц, содержащих s в имени.
\i FILE - выполнить команды из файла FILE.
\o FILE - сохранить результат запроса в файл FILE.
\a - переключение между режимами вывода: с/без выравнивания.

вторник, 12 марта 2019 г.

Настройки для nethasp.conf

Для работы 1С с HASP ключом добавляем в файл C:\Program Files (x86)\1cv8\conf

[NH_COMMON]
NH_TCPIP = Enabled
[NH_TCPIP]
NH_SERVER_ADDR = IP Address HASP Server
NH_TCPIP_METHOD = UDP
NH_USE_BROADCAST = Disabled